Why Removal Jobs Become Time-Critical
In South Austin TX, junk removal usually becomes a timing issue before it becomes a cleanup issue. A garage sale that did not happen, a rental turnover that ran long, or an inherited home full of furniture can turn into a real scheduling problem fast.
Real estate work magnifies small messes. One couch in the wrong room, a stack of broken shelving in the garage, or tenant abandoned belongings in the back bedroom can delay photos, showings, and inspections.
The difference is in execution. A reliable team knows how to move quickly, protect floors and walls, and keep the site from turning into a bigger mess during removal.

Getting The Property Ready For What Comes Next
The best cleanup jobs are the ones that make the next contractor's work easier. After the junk is gone, the property can be cleaned, painted, repaired, photographed, or handed back without anyone stepping around leftover clutter.
For landlords, flippers, and agents, the goal is usually simple: reduce friction. If the property still has tenant abandoned belongings, broken furniture, or leftover debris, every later step takes longer.
